Description

A flaw was found in python. An improperly handled HTTP response in the HTTP client code of python may allow a remote attacker, who controls the HTTP server, to make the client script enter an infinite loop, consuming CPU time. The highest threat from this vulnerability is to system availability.

Is CVE-2021-3737 being actively exploited?

Not that we know of. CVE-2021-3737 is not in the CISA Known Exploited Vulnerabilities catalog. Its EPSS score of 11.6% is the estimated probability that it will be exploited in the next 30 days. That is higher than 96% of all scored CVEs.

How severe is CVE-2021-3737?

CVE-2021-3737 has a CVSS v3 base score of 7.5, rated high. CVSS rates the technical impact if the vulnerability is exploited, not how likely that is, so weigh it alongside the exploit-prediction score when you decide what to patch first.
